- Description:
- Graduates of Morehouse University in Atlanta, one of the most prestigious historically Black colleges in the nation, proceed through campus during a baccalaureate ceremony.
Photograph of graduates of Morehouse University in Atlanta, Georgia proceeding through campus during a baccalaureate ceremony. A long line of graduates wearing black robes and mortarboards extends behind several faculty members, also clad in academic costume. The graduates walk past several campus buildings.
Morehouse College is one of ten historically black colleges and universities in Georgia. Located a few miles from downtown Atlanta in the historic West End district, Morehouse is one of only five all-male colleges in the United States and the only one for African Americans. - Metadata URL:
